Vaucluse's 4th constituency
The 4th constituency of the Vaucluse (French: Quatrième circonscription de Vaucluse) is a French legislative constituency in the Vaucluse département. Like the other 576 French constituencies, it elects one MP using the two-round system, with a run-off if no candidate receives over 50% of the vote in the first round.
